This briefing summarises the launch plan for Quellane, Ardenfield Systems' new scheduling product. Rollout begins with a limited release in the Tollmere region, followed by general availability eight weeks later. Pricing is tiered, with an introductory discount for existing Ardenfield customers. Marketing spend is front-loaded into the first month, and support staffing has been increased accordingly. Risks centre on supply of onboarding capacity. The confidential note on business plans is appended immediately below this briefing.

management briefing: Only 3 of the 140 pilot accounts renewed Oliix, so a churn review is set for July 1.

Action item (P2, owner: export squad): During the Fernvale outage, spreadsheet exports over 40k rows ballooned memory on the worker pool and starved other jobs. Interim mitigation caps exports at 25k rows; support should set that expectation with customers until streaming export ships. If a customer reports a failed or truncated export, gather the export ID and row count before escalating. The capped-export workaround and escalation steps are documented on this internal page.

runbook for fahip-yadup: https://confluence.zemvarlabs.internal/browse/browse/projects/display/03de

## Deployment

Quillforge pins every dependency. Plugin authors: your manifest must declare exact versions, not ranges. Builds with floating versions are rejected at the gate, no exceptions. Transitive dependencies are resolved once at release cut and frozen in the lockset; you cannot override them at install time. To request a pin bump, file a change against the lockset repo and wait for the weekly review. Deploys pull the frozen lockset and verify checksums before rollout. The deploy gate enforces the following configuration.

service settings:
[casax]
port = 6379
team = rusir
host = casax.zemvarhq.corp
region = outer-4
access_code = ac_9808ce
timeout_ms = 1500